Time now to make a start on the wings...The preliminary jigs take care of the gull bend; later, an entirely different set of jigs will set the wing up without any unwanted twists. The main spars are 5mm sq spruce, with some of the tension steamed out at the gull change...

With the dihedral check safely passed, the brass boxes (one 13mm, one 15mm) can be epoxied in and closed off. Then it's time to fit the sub spars in front of the web plates...

With the lower sheeting added in two sections, preparations are made before adding the top sheeting, which will be in three parts. The centre sheeting spans the gull break and is forced into a compound curve to preserve a smooth transition around the bend...
